If the tool fails to recognize the device, clean the phone's connection pins, check your cable, or re-install the Nokia Connectivity Cable Drivers.
| Error | Solution | |-------|----------| | | Reinstall USB drivers, try different USB port (2.0 not 3.0). | | ADL Loader error | Replace USB cable; disable antivirus temporarily. | | Dead after flash | Remove battery for 10 sec → reinsert → boot. | | Wrong file version | Re-download and confirm MD5 checksum. | 50–70 MB (full package) | | Flash tool
